Arriving through LIQ puts you in Lisala, a Congo River town shaped by river trade, colonial extraction, rainforest communities, independence history, equatorial weather, and infrastructure that refuses brochure-ready simplification. Closest Weird Shit

Look beyond the obvious for Mongo and other local histories through responsible sources, colonial and mission remnants, old cemeteries, river-port labor, independence memory, and rainforest ecology. That is where the place stops performing for brochures and starts explaining itself.

Current conflict and security conditions can change quickly; follow official travel advice, avoid contested areas, and never photograph military, government, airport, aid, protest, or critical infrastructure.

Best Photo Spots

The strongest frames come from river pirogues with consent, public mission architecture, market color, forest edges, working waterfront from safe public areas, and equatorial storms. Early or late light helps, as does remembering that no resident, ritual, ruin, or animal exists merely as content.

Stay on legal public ground, protect fragile places, and treat living communities as people rather than scenery.
